General Information

Title: Ut queant laxis
Composer: Orlando di Lasso

Number of voices: 5vv   Voicing: SATTB

Genre: SacredOffice hymn

Language: Latin
Instruments: A cappella

{{Published}} is obsolete (code commented out), replaced with {{Pub}} for works and {{PubDatePlace}} for publications.

Description: Tenor 1 sings the notes of the scale
